  • What is the appropriate size of a solar energy storage box for home use

    What is the appropriate size of a solar energy storage box for home use

    A simple rule of thumb for sizing battery storage involves using a straightforward ratio based on your daily energy consumption. 5 times your average daily kilowatt-hour (kWh) usage.


    FAQs about What is the appropriate size of a solar energy storage box for home use

    What is Solar Battery sizing?

    Key terminologies associated with solar battery sizing include: Kilowatt-hour (kWh): A unit of energy measurement, representing the amount of energy consumed or produced over one hour. It is used to quantify the energy storage capacity of solar batteries. Capacity: Refers to the total amount of energy that a solar battery can store.

    What is battery storage system sizing?

    Battery storage system sizing is significantly more complicated than sizing a solar-only system. While solar panels generate energy, batteries only store it, so their usability (as well as their value) is based first and foremost on the energy available to fill them up (which usually comes from your solar panels).

    How do I choose a solar battery size?

    Coordinate the sizing of your solar battery with the capacity and production of your solar panel system. The solar panels generate electricity that powers the home and charges the battery, so the sizing should be proportional to ensure efficient utilization of the solar energy harvested. Consider the pricing structure of your electrical grid rates.

    Can a solar battery power an entire home?

    The ability of one solar battery to power an entire home depends on factors such as the home's energy consumption, solar panel system size, and battery capacity. Multiple batteries may be needed for sustained power during periods without sunlight or in the event of a power outage, especially with smaller-capacity batteries.

    Do you need a solar battery for a whole-home backup?

    For those seeking comprehensive energy independence, sizing a solar battery for whole-home backup becomes essential. This involves determining the total energy consumption of the entire household and selecting sufficient capacity to sustain the entire home during power outages.

    Why should a solar battery be sized appropriately?

    It encompasses factors such as cost savings through load shifting, backup options for essential systems, and the potential for whole-home backup solutions. One of the key advantages of sizing a solar battery appropriately is the potential for cost savings through load shifting.

  • What is 100 Euro solar power like

    What is 100 Euro solar power like

    consists of (PV) and in the (EU). In 2010, the €2.6 billion European solar heating sectors consisted of small and medium-sized businesses, generated 17.3 terawatt-hours (TWh) of energy, employed 33,500 workers, and created one new job for every 80 kW of added.


    FAQs about What is 100 Euro solar power like

    Why is solar energy so popular in Europe?

    Solar energy is cheap, clean and flexible. The cost of solar power decreased by 82% between 2010-2020, making it the most competitive source of electricity in many parts of the EU. The EU solar generation capacity keeps increasing and reached, according to SolarPower Europe, an estimated 259.99 GW in 2023.

    How much solar power does the EU have in 2023?

    The EU solar generation capacity keeps increasing and reached, according to SolarPower Europe, an estimated 259.99 GW in 2023. The EU has long been a front-runner in the roll-out of solar energy. Under the European Green Deal and the REPowerEU plan, solar power is a building block of the EU's transition to cleaner energy.

    How much solar energy will Europe have in 2020?

    According to the National Renewable Energy Action Plans the total solar thermal capacity in the EU will be 102 GW in 2020 (while 14 GW in 2006). In June 2009, the European Parliament and Council adopted the Directive on the promotion of the use of energy from Renewable Energy Sources (RES).

    How much solar power does Europe produce?

    PV is now a significant part of Europe's electricity mix, producing 2% of the demand in the EU and roughly 4% of peak demand. PV roof-top system in Berlin, Germany. In 2011 the EU's solar electricity production is evaluated as ca 44.8 TWh in 2011 with 51.4 GW installed capacity, up 98% on 2010. In 2011 in the EU new installations were 21.5 GW.

    Is the EU ready for solar energy?

    The EU has long been a front-runner in the roll-out of solar energy. Under the European Green Deal and the REPowerEU plan, solar power is a building block of the EU's transition to cleaner energy. Its accelerated deployment contributes to reducing the EU's dependence on imported fossil fuels.

    Which country has the most solar power in Europe?

    In terms of cumulative capacity, Germany with more than 24 GW, is the leading country in Europe, followed by Italy, with more than 12 GW. PV is now a significant part of Europe's electricity mix, producing 2% of the demand in the EU and roughly 4% of peak demand. PV roof-top system in Berlin, Germany.
